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a team of technicians to assess the damage and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ry your property.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to find out the extent of the damage and identify the best course of action.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the water from your property. Our technicians will work quickly to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ized equipment to dry your property and remove any remaining moisture. This step is crucial to prevent secondary damage and mold growth.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

We’ll use sanitizing agents to ensure that your property is safe and clean. Our technicians will disinfect all surfaces and ensure that your home is free from bacteria and other contaminants.

Sink Overflow Water Removal Cost in Williamson, NY

The cost of sink overflow water removal in Williamson, NY,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of the damage and size of the affected area
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area and local humidity levels
Sanitizing and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Severity of the damage and type of surfaces affected
Equipment rental and usage $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ed
Travel and labor costs $500 – $2,000 Distance from our location and complexity of the job

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of sink overflow water removal may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ates and can provide a more accurate quote after assessing the damage.
